WebAnswer (1 of 5): When I suspect a failing PSU, I pull out the volt meter and check voltages across each rail when it is running. Static voltage with no load does not tell the whole story. WebThe first step in troubleshooting a bad power supply is to do a visual inspection. Inspect the exterior of the power supply for any signs of physical damage such as bulging capacitors, melted wires, dents or scratches. WebSometimes, bad caps can be identified by certain physical characteristics, including: Bulged appearance. Domed tops. Asymmetrical or stretched plastic jacket. Fluid leaking. Split vents. Symptoms of defective capacitors may include: Excessive noise in audio or video, including 60hz audio hum or rolling bars in video. WebSudden Failures. In this case, everything is working normally, then suddenly stops. This can mean no output, a burning smell sometimes accompanied by smoke, a blown fuse, loud noises (hums, buzzes, crackles), etc. Usually a component has opened or shorted, or an electrical connection has come undone.
